Webb16 jan. 2014 · The mechanism by which GLP-1 affects gastrointestinal motility is not fully understood but seems to be neurally mediated ( 17 ). For example, GLP-1 has been shown to inhibit gastropancreatic function by inhibiting central parasympathetic outflow ( 18 ); the effect of GLP-1 on GE is lost in subjects who underwent truncal vagotomy ( 19 ). A wireless motility study evaluates the time it takes for your stomach to empty. This is generally well tolerated and less invasive than other diagnostic studies.
